How can I verify the legitimacy of an online shop selling cryptocurrencies?
I want to buy cryptocurrencies from an online shop, but I'm worried about its legitimacy. How can I verify if the shop is trustworthy and reliable?
3 answers
- b_mJun 27, 2023 · 3 years agoOne way to verify the legitimacy of an online shop selling cryptocurrencies is to check if it is registered and licensed. Look for information about the shop's registration and licensing on their website or contact their customer support for more details. Additionally, you can search for reviews and feedback from other customers to get an idea of their experiences with the shop. It's also important to check if the shop has proper security measures in place to protect your personal and financial information.
- Elias Dalla CorteDec 26, 2020 · 5 years agoVerifying the legitimacy of an online shop selling cryptocurrencies can be challenging, but there are a few steps you can take to minimize the risk. First, research the shop's reputation and history. Look for any negative reviews or complaints from customers. Second, check if the shop has a physical address and contact information. Legitimate shops usually provide this information to establish trust. Third, consider using escrow services or reputable payment platforms that offer buyer protection. Finally, trust your instincts. If something feels off or too good to be true, it's better to be cautious and find another shop.
- John TakerJul 27, 2023 · 3 years agoWhen it comes to verifying the legitimacy of an online shop selling cryptocurrencies, it's essential to do your due diligence. One way to start is by checking if the shop is listed on reputable cryptocurrency exchanges or platforms. These exchanges often have strict listing criteria and conduct thorough background checks on the shops they allow to operate on their platforms. Another important factor to consider is the shop's transparency. Legitimate shops usually provide clear information about their team, location, and regulatory compliance. Lastly, look for any red flags such as unrealistic promises or suspicious payment methods.
